Comment(by wmb at firmworks.com):
/ofw/architecture => "OLPC"
/ofw/model => "C2"
/ofw/banner-name => "OLPC C2"
Why doesn't it say "XO"? For the usual reason - the firmware and software
have to choose and wire-in names long before marketing has decided what to
call the machine (or before they have stopped changing their minds). Once
the names have been wired in, changing them can require a flag day.
